Hard VerseThe Yoga of Knowledge and Action
Whenever and wherever there is a decline in religious practice, O descendant of Bharata, and a predominant rise of irreligion—at that time I descend Myself.
Context & Meaning
Whenever dharma (righteousness) declines and adharma (unrighteousness) rises, Krishna manifests on Earth. This is the divine law of cyclical renewal.

1 commentary · Public domainSwami Vivekananda
VedanticThis is one of the most universal statements in all religious literature. It does not say "wherever Hinduism declines" but wherever dharma declines — dharma being the universal moral order that underlies all religions. The Avatar principle thus acknowledges that the Divine responds to the moral state of the world, not merely of one tradition.
